4-Amino-3,5-dibromobenzoic acid

4-Amino-3,5-dibromobenzoic acid Structure
  • ₹0
  • Product name: 4-Amino-3,5-dibromobenzoic acid
  • CAS: 4123-72-2
  • MF: C7H5Br2NO2
  • MW: 294.93
  • EINECS:
  • MDL Number:MFCD00075845
  • Synonyms:4-AMINO-3,5-DIBROMOBENZOIC ACID;BUTTPARK 35\03-07;4- aMino-3,5- twobroMo benzoic acid;3,5-Dibromo-4-aminobenzoicacid;RARECHEM AL BO 2270;4-Amino-3,5-dibromobenzoic acid 95+%;Benzoic acid, 4-amino-3,5-dibromo-

Properties

Melting point :330 °C (decomp)
Boiling point :391.1±42.0 °C(Predicted)
Density :2.158±0.06 g/cm3(Predicted)
storage temp. :Keep in dark place,Inert atmosphere,Room temperature
pka :4.08±0.10(Predicted)
CAS DataBase Reference :4123-72-2(CAS DataBase Reference)

Safety Information

Symbol(GHS): GHS hazard pictograms
Signal word: Warning
Hazard statements:
Code Hazard statements Hazard class Category Signal word Pictogram P-Codes
H315 Causes skin irritation Skin corrosion/irritation Category 2 Warning GHS hazard pictograms P264, P280, P302+P352, P321,P332+P313, P362
H319 Causes serious eye irritation Serious eye damage/eye irritation Category 2A Warning GHS hazard pictograms P264, P280, P305+P351+P338,P337+P313P
H335 May cause respiratory irritation Specific target organ toxicity, single exposure;Respiratory tract irritation Category 3 Warning GHS hazard pictograms
Precautionary statements:
P261 Avoid breathing dust/fume/gas/mist/vapours/spray.
P305+P351+P338 IF IN EYES: Rinse cautiously with water for several minutes. Remove contact lenses, if present and easy to do. Continuerinsing.
